Ghostbusters: Frozen Empire - watch online: stream, buy or rent
Currently you are able to watch "Ghostbusters: Frozen Empire" streaming on Amazon Prime Video, Neon TV. It is also possible to buy "Ghostbusters: Frozen Empire" on Apple TV, Microsoft Store as download or rent it on Apple TV, Neon TV, Microsoft Store online.